Abstract

The system includes a battery charger (300) and a battery pack (100).
Upon insertion of the battery pack (100) into a retention area (303) of the battery charger (300), a battery pack channel (101) and a corresponding battery charger rail (305) align the battery pack electrical contacts (201) with the electrical contacts (309) of the battery charger. In order to ensure that a reliable electrical connection is made between the two sets of contacts (201, 309), a compliance rib (501) is disposed within the channel (101) of the battery pack (100). The compliance rib (501) creates an interference between the rail (305) and the channel (101), consequently, creating a force against the rail. The interference is calculated to create a sufficient force in combination with the force created by the weight of the battery pack (100) such that the force of the battery pack meets or exceeds the force created by the set of electrical contacts in the battery charger.
